The White Lotus Season 3 Finale: 4 Possible Climaxes
1. Timothy Ratliff Poisons His Family
Timothy Ratliff (Jason Isaacs) has been slowly unravelling throughout the season, sinking into suicidal thoughts while becoming addicted to his wife's Lorazepam. Realising that his family is completely unprepared for financial disaster, he starts to believe their only escape is death. While his storyline has felt a bit repetitive, Jason Isaacs' performance has been outstanding.

A popular theory, especially on Reddit is that Tim will blend the deadly suicide fruit into Saxon's (Patrick Schwarzenegger) protein shakes, taking out himself and his family in one go. While this seems like a simple and logical conclusion, it also feels too predictable. And if there's one thing ‘The White Lotus’ creator Mike White isn’t, it’s predictable. Tim poisoning the shakes could happen, but for a show full of surprises, there’s likely a bigger twist ahead.
Another possibility I see is that, instead of his daughter, Tim might choose to join the monastery. Given his current state of mind, seeking refuge in a place of spiritual isolation could be his way of escaping his problems without resorting to violence. If ‘The White Lotus’ has taught us anything, it’s that the most unexpected paths often turn out to be the real ones.

2. Rick Ends Up In Trouble
Let’s be real, we all have a soft spot for Rick Hatchett (Walton Goggins), the rugged man on a lifelong quest for vengeance. But when he finally confronts his father’s killer, the moment falls flat. Instead of pulling the trigger, he barely musters the will to push the frail old man. In the end, his closure comes from realising his enemy isn’t the monster he imagined.
However, Rick isn’t off the hook. He attacked the husband of the resort owner, deceived Sritala (Lek Patravadi), and even pulled a gun on her husband. With his details logged in the hotel records, trouble is inevitable. Even his girlfriend Chelsea (Aimee Lou Wood) sees the storm coming, believing they’re locked in a battle of hope versus pain. The real worry? That she, not Rick, will pay the price, especially after already escaping death twice.
3. Deadly Twist
As the police storm the resort, panic spreads like wildfire. Rick is convinced they’re coming for him. Gary fears he’s the target. Timothy believes his past has finally caught up with him. But in reality, it was Gaitok who called them, for Valentino and his crew.
I came across this theory on Reddit, and honestly, it has a high chance of happening. Given that ‘The White Lotus’ loves to kill off our favourite characters, Chelsea might just be the next victim. Amid all the confusion, she becomes the tragic casualty, whether by a stray bullet, a wrong move, or sheer bad luck, she doesn’t make it out alive.

4. Mook Is Actually A Villian
The casting of global superstar Lalisa Manobal, best known as a member of ‘Blackpink,’ caused a stir online. Throughout the season, her character, Mook, a seemingly quiet hotel employee and Gaitok’s (Tayme Thapthimthong) love interest has left fans questioning if there’s more to her than her sweet demeanour suggests.
And honestly, I think there is. For starters, her interactions with Gaitok are painfully dull, so much so that they feel unnecessary. Many speculate that Mook is secretly working with Valentino (Arnas Fedaravicius) and his crew to pull off a robbery. While that theory makes sense, it also feels too predictable. Given Mike White’s knack for unexpected twists, there’s likely a much bigger reveal waiting for us.
